This authentic vintage Waldow Brooklyn, New York copper saute pan is a premium, American-made culinary piece built for exceptional stovetop performance. It features a heavy-gauge copper body paired with a traditional, dual-riveted long brass handle on the lid and a secure three-rivet brass handle on the main pan for excellent durability and balance. The base of the pan is stamped clearly with the collectible "WALDOW BKLYN. N.Y." maker mark.
Regarding specifications, this is a size 16 pan, which features an internal diameter measuring approximately 6.5 inches excluding the lip, and a depth of just about 2 inches. The total commercial-grade weight registers at 2 lbs 11.9 oz with the matching lid included.
In terms of condition, the saute pan is in good vintage shape with an unpolished exterior showing a rich, authentic patina and minor oxidation near the handle joints. The interior features a solid, intact tin lining with normal coloration from culinary use, making it fully ready for a working kitchen or a classic cookware collection.
